Plot
On the day of his scheduled execution, a convicted serial killer is the subject of a last-minute court-ordered psychiatric evaluation. The murderer surprises the psychiatrist by stating that, instead of trying to avoid his fate, he is actually a demon and wants the execution to go ahead b>. Furthermore, he announces to the doctor that he will commit three murders before he finishes the interview.
Is Nefarious the alter ego of a convicted serial killer or a demonic being? The decision is in your hands. The execution of Edward Wayne Brady will be carried out, as long as he passes the psychiatric evaluation to be declared mentally fit b>. However, in a verbal confrontation with his evaluator, he engages in a deadly game of chess, playing cat and mouse.
Dr. James Martin (Jordan Belfi), psychiatrist skeptical of the supernatural, denies the existence of God and demons. Although he has the ability to decide on the life and death of Edward Wayne Brady, a serial killer, Dr. Martin ignores that there are dark forces related to the convict that exert a strong power. on him and that put his life in danger.
Directed by Cary Solomon from a script by Chuck Conzelman and Sean Patrick Flanery in the role of Nefarious.

Trivia
Promoter cameo
Glenn Beck plays in a cameo at the end. Beck was one of the first notable people to promote and champion the book, "A Nefarious Plot," which eventually helped lead to it being greenlit.
Author cameo
At 45:13 of the movie, when Dr. Martin is talking to the guard, there is an article on the computer monitor announcing a new Superintendent of the Board of Prisons. The man in the photo is Steve Deace, author of the novel on which he is based.
Flanery Top 3
Sean Patrick Flanery considered this to be among the top three films he was most proud of making.
